National Academy of Science Releases IT Report

National Academy of Science Releases IT Report

WASHINGTON
The use of the Internet and the growth of other electronic-commerce technologies have fundamentally changed the way the government delivers services to citizens, businesses and other government entities.
“Information, Technology Research, Innovation, and e-Government,” a new report from the National Academies’ National Research Council, examines the alliance between researchers and government in designing and building enhanced digital systems and services. The report explores challenges the government faces in information technology research and examines strategies for turning innovative ideas into actual operational systems.
